Html import dimension conversions (#2152)
Allows basic column width conversion when importing from Html that includes UoM... while not overly-sophisticated in converting units to MS Excel's column width units, it should allow import without errors Also provides a general conversion helper class, and allows column width getters/setters to specify a UoM for easier usage

@ -1207,6 +1217,16 @@ Excel measures row height in points, where 1 pt is 1/72 of an inch (or
|
|||
about 0.35mm). The default value is 12.75 pts; and the permitted range
|
||||
of values is between 0 and 409 pts, where 0 pts is a hidden row.
|
||||
|
||||
If you want to set a row height using a different unit of measure,
|
||||
then you can do so by telling PhpSpreadsheet what UoM the height value
|
||||
that you are setting is measured in.
|
||||
Valid units are `pt` (points), `px` (pixels), `pc` (pica), `in` (inches),
|
||||
`cm` (centimeters) and `mm` (millimeters).
|
||||
|
||||
```php
|
||||
$spreadsheet->getActiveSheet()->getRowDimension('10')->setRowHeight(100, 'pt');
|
||||
```

Excel measures column width in its own proprietary units, based on the number
|
||||
of characters that will be displayed in the default font.
|
||||
|
||||
If you want to set the default column width using a different unit of measure,
|
||||
then you can do so by telling PhpSpreadsheet what UoM the width value
|
||||
that you are setting is measured in.
|
||||
Valid units are `pt` (points), `px` (pixels), `pc` (pica), `in` (inches),
|
||||
`cm` (centimeters) and `mm` (millimeters).
|
||||
|
||||
```php
|
||||
$spreadsheet->getActiveSheet()->getDefaultColumnDimension()->setWidth(400, 'pt');
|
||||
```
|
||||
and PhpSpreadsheet will handle the internal conversion.

<?php
|
||||
|
||||
namespace PhpOffice\PhpSpreadsheet\Helper;
|
||||
|
||||
use PhpOffice\PhpSpreadsheet\Exception;
|
||||
use PhpOffice\PhpSpreadsheet\Shared\Drawing;
|
||||
use PhpOffice\PhpSpreadsheet\Style\Font;
|
||||
|
||||
class Dimension
|
||||
{
|
||||
public const UOM_CENTIMETERS = 'cm';
|
||||
public const UOM_MILLIMETERS = 'mm';
|
||||
public const UOM_INCHES = 'in';
|
||||
public const UOM_PIXELS = 'px';
|
||||
public const UOM_POINTS = 'pt';
|
||||
public const UOM_PICA = 'pc';
|
||||
|
||||
/**
|
||||
* Based on 96 dpi.
|
||||
*/
|
||||
const ABSOLUTE_UNITS = [
|
||||
self::UOM_CENTIMETERS => 96.0 / 2.54,
|
||||
self::UOM_MILLIMETERS => 96.0 / 25.4,
|
||||
self::UOM_INCHES => 96.0,
|
||||
self::UOM_PIXELS => 1.0,
|
||||
self::UOM_POINTS => 96.0 / 72,
|
||||
self::UOM_PICA => 96.0 * 12 / 72,
|
||||
];
|
||||
|
||||
/**
|
||||
* Based on a standard column width of 8.54 units in MS Excel.
|
||||
*/
|
||||
const RELATIVE_UNITS = [
|
||||
'em' => 10.0 / 8.54,
|
||||
'ex' => 10.0 / 8.54,
|
||||
'ch' => 10.0 / 8.54,
|
||||
'rem' => 10.0 / 8.54,
|
||||
'vw' => 8.54,
|
||||
'vh' => 8.54,
|
||||
'vmin' => 8.54,
|
||||
'vmax' => 8.54,
|
||||
'%' => 8.54 / 100,
|
||||
];
|
||||
|
||||
/**
|
||||
* @var float|int If this is a width, then size is measured in pixels (if is set)
|
||||
* or in Excel's default column width units if $unit is null.
|
||||
* If this is a height, then size is measured in pixels ()
|
||||
* or in points () if $unit is null.
|
||||
*/
|
||||
protected $size;
|
||||
|
||||
/**
|
||||
* @var null|string
|
||||
*/
|
||||
protected $unit;
|
||||
|
||||
public function __construct(string $dimension)
|
||||
{
|
||||
[$size, $unit] = sscanf($dimension, '%[1234567890.]%s');
|
||||
$unit = strtolower(trim($unit));
|
||||
|
||||
// If a UoM is specified, then convert the size to pixels for internal storage
|
||||
if (isset(self::ABSOLUTE_UNITS[$unit])) {
|
||||
$size *= self::ABSOLUTE_UNITS[$unit];
|
||||
$this->unit = self::UOM_PIXELS;
|
||||
} elseif (isset(self::RELATIVE_UNITS[$unit])) {
|
||||
$size *= self::RELATIVE_UNITS[$unit];
|
||||
$size = round($size, 4);
|
||||
}
|
||||
|
||||
$this->size = $size;
|
||||
}
|
||||
|
||||
public function width(): float
|
||||
{
|
||||
return (float) ($this->unit === null)
|
||||
? $this->size
|
||||
: round(Drawing::pixelsToCellDimension((int) $this->size, new Font(false)), 4);
|
||||
}
|
||||
|
||||
public function height(): float
|
||||
{
|
||||
return (float) ($this->unit === null)
|
||||
? $this->size
|
||||
: $this->toUnit(self::UOM_POINTS);
|
||||
}
|
||||
|
||||
public function toUnit(string $unitOfMeasure): float
|
||||
{
|
||||
$unitOfMeasure = strtolower($unitOfMeasure);
|
||||
if (!array_key_exists($unitOfMeasure, self::ABSOLUTE_UNITS)) {
|
||||
throw new Exception("{$unitOfMeasure} is not a vaid unit of measure");
|
||||
}
|
||||
|
||||
$size = $this->size;
|
||||
if ($this->unit === null) {
|
||||
$size = Drawing::cellDimensionToPixels($size, new Font(false));
|
||||
}
|
||||
|
||||
return $size / self::ABSOLUTE_UNITS[$unitOfMeasure];
|
||||
}
|
||||
}
